
Parachuting into the Giant Crystal Gateway – Fantastic Adventures June 1949
A faceted crystalline jewel the size of a skyscraper dominates the right side of the canvas, its geometric planes catching beams of otherworldly light — this is the gateway at the heart of the story. Three figures in golden jumpsuits descend on parachutes toward jagged alien spires rising from a mountain range bathed in volcanic orange sky. The composition crackles with pulp urgency: small human figures dwarfed by impossible geology, a world both beautiful and lethal waiting below.
The concept of a gigantic jewel functioning as a dimensional gateway, combined with parachuting adventurers descending into alien spires, shows genuine pulp ambition. The cover sells a complete sense of wonder — scale, danger, and mystery — in a single arresting image.
